Incumbent president Abdulla Yameen Abdul Gayoom Thursday looked to sway his nephew -- youngest son of ruling Progressive Party of Maldives (PPM) leader Maumoon Abdul Gayoom to his faction of the now divided party with the promise of a parliament seat.

Ghassan Maumoon is the only child of the elder Gayoom who has thus far refused to take sides in the bitter power struggle between his father and uncle.
